Product Introduction

Overview

The PCA9517DRG4, produced by Texas Instruments, is a 2-bit level-translating 400-kHz I2C/SMBus buffer/repeater. This device is designed to extend I2C and SMBus systems by allowing the connection of two buses with up to 400-pF bus capacitance each. It supports voltage-level translation between low voltages (as low as 0.9 V) and higher voltages (2.7 V to 5.5 V), making it suitable for mixed-mode applications. The PCA9517 also enables the isolation of two halves of a bus for voltage and capacitance, enhancing system flexibility and reliability.

Key Features

  • Voltage-Level Translation: Supports translation between low voltages (down to 0.9 V) and higher voltages (2.7 V to 5.5 V).
  • Bus Extension and Isolation: Allows the connection of two buses with up to 400-pF bus capacitance each and isolates two halves of a bus for voltage and capacitance.
  • Active-High Enable Input: With an internal pullup to VCCB, allowing selective activation of the repeater.
  • Open-Drain I2C I/O: Compatible with standard I2C systems, requiring pullup resistors.
  • Lockup-Free Operation: Ensures reliable operation without bus lockups.
  • Multiple Device Connection: Supports star topography and series connection of multiple PCA9517s without offset voltage buildup.

Q & A

  1. What is the primary function of the PCA9517?

    The PCA9517 is a 2-bit level-translating 400-kHz I2C/SMBus buffer/repeater designed to extend and isolate I2C/SMBus buses.

  2. What is the operating supply voltage range for the PCA9517?

    The operating supply voltage range is from 0.9 V to 5.5 V for both VCCA and VCCB.

  3. Can the PCA9517 handle high bus capacitance?

    Yes, it can handle up to 400-pF bus capacitance per connected bus.

  4. Is the PCA9517 tolerant to overvoltage?

    Yes, all inputs and I/Os are overvoltage tolerant up to 5.5 V, even when the device is unpowered.

  5. How does the enable input work on the PCA9517?

    The PCA9517 has an active-high enable input with an internal pullup to VCCB, allowing selective activation of the repeater.

  6. Can multiple PCA9517s be connected in series?

    Yes, multiple PCA9517s can be connected in series (A side to B side) without any buildup in offset voltage and with only time-of-flight delays to consider.

  7. Does the PCA9517 support clock stretching and arbitration?

    No, the PCA9517 does not support clock stretching and arbitration across the repeater.

  8. What are the conditions for enabling the drivers on the PCA9517?

    The drivers are enabled when VCCA is above 0.8 V and VCCB is above 2.5 V.

  9. Can the PCA9517 be used in star topography configurations?

    Yes, the A side of two or more PCA9517s can be connected together to allow a star topography with the A side on the common bus.
